About Oldenzaal
Oldenzaal is a historic town in the Twente region of Overijssel, just 10 km north of Enschede and close to the German border. It is best known for the Plechelmusbasiliek, a magnificent Romanesque basilica that is one of the finest in the Netherlands. The town's old centre has a pleasant, relaxed atmosphere with market squares and historic buildings.

By Train
Oldenzaal station is on the regional line between Enschede and Hengelo, with trains at least twice hourly. From Enschede it is 10 minutes; from Hengelo 8 minutes.
By Car
The A1 motorway is just south of the town (exit 32). Driving from Amsterdam takes about 1 hour 40 minutes.
Things to do
Plechelmusbasiliek — A stunning 12th-century Romanesque basilica with a massive westwork, one of the oldest churches in the Netherlands; free to enter
Oldenzaal old town — A small but well-preserved centre with the Palthehuis (a 17th-century merchant's house, now a hotel)
De Heimsheek — A nature reserve just outside town, good for walks
Carnaval — Oldenzaal is one of the best places in Twente to experience Carnaval (February/March), with parades, costumes and street parties
Cycle to Losser — a scenic 10-km route through Twente farmland
